Document findings with specific metrics. Rather than noting “site is slow,” record “homepage loads in 6.2 seconds on 4G mobile.” Precise data guides effective fixes. Explore automotive marketing tips for industry benchmarks, and review automotive web design examples showing optimized layouts.
Step 2: Implement Technical and On-Page SEO Improvements
With audit insights, tackle technical and content optimizations systematically. Site speed improvements deliver immediate returns. Websites with fast loading times under 3 seconds have 70% lower bounce rates and rank higher in organic search results. Compress images, enable browser caching, minimize CSS and JavaScript files, and consider a content delivery network for UK users.
Add automotive-specific structured data to vehicle listings, service pages, and business profiles. This markup increases visibility in search results through rich snippets showing prices, availability, and ratings. Implementation requires technical knowledge but pays dividends through higher click-through rates.
Optimize meta titles and descriptions with UK local keywords that match how customers search. Rather than generic “Car Repairs,” use “MOT and Car Servicing in Manchester City Centre.” Each page needs unique, compelling metadata that accurately describes content while incorporating search terms.
Pro Tip: Test every optimization on mobile devices first. Over 65% of automotive searches now happen on smartphones, making mobile performance the priority rather than an afterthought.
Ensure full responsive design across all device types. Pages must adapt layouts, not just shrink desktop versions. Navigation should work with thumbs, not mouse pointers. Forms need large tap targets and minimal required fields.
Implementation checklist:
Achieve Core Web Vitals scores in “good” range for all pages
Deploy schema markup for LocalBusiness, AutoDealer, or AutoRepair as appropriate
Rewrite meta titles to 50 to 60 characters including location and service keywords
Create unique meta descriptions for every service and location page
Verify mobile usability through Google Search Console reports
Regularly update on-page elements as UK market trends shift. What works for searches today may need adjustment as customer behavior evolves. Technical SEO improvements require ongoing attention, not one-time fixes.

Step 4: Optimize Local SEO and Paid Advertising Integration
Local visibility determines success for most UK automotive businesses. Claim and fully optimize your Google My Business profile with accurate hours, services, photos, and regular posts. Complete profiles rank higher in local map packs, capturing customers searching for nearby solutions.
Incorporate UK local keywords naturally throughout website content. Each service page should mention specific towns, neighborhoods, or regions you serve. Create dedicated location pages if you operate multiple sites or serve distinct areas within a city.
Paid advertising complements organic local SEO by capturing high-intent searches immediately. Google Ads campaigns targeting location-specific automotive keywords deliver qualified traffic while your organic rankings improve. Facebook Ads reach local audiences based on demographics, interests, and behaviors beyond search intent.
Strategy | Timeline to Results | Cost Structure | Best For |
Organic Local SEO | 8 to 12 weeks | Time investment, content creation | Long-term sustainable traffic |
Google Ads | Immediate | Pay per click, ongoing budget | Quick lead generation, seasonal promotions |
Facebook Ads | 2 to 4 weeks | Pay per impression/click | Brand awareness, remarketing to site visitors |
Monitor ROI metrics religiously. Track cost per lead, conversion rates, and customer lifetime value for each channel. Adjust budgets toward highest-performing campaigns while pausing or refining underperformers. Many businesses waste 30 to 40% of advertising spend on poorly targeted or unmonitored campaigns.
Local SEO strategies require consistent execution across multiple platforms. Update Google My Business weekly with posts, photos, and offers. Encourage satisfied customers to leave reviews and respond professionally to all feedback, positive or negative.

Common Mistakes and Troubleshooting in Automotive Website Optimization
Avoiding frequent errors accelerates results and prevents wasted resources. Neglecting mobile usability causes about 60% of UK users to leave automotive sites immediately. Fix this by implementing responsive design, testing on actual devices, and prioritizing mobile user experience over desktop aesthetics.
Skipping structured data markup reduces traffic by up to 20% because search engines cannot properly categorize and display your content in rich results. Implement automotive schema for vehicles, services, reviews, and business information to capture this lost visibility.
Overinvesting in flashy features without measuring ROI wastes budgets on tools that look impressive but generate few leads. Focus resources on proven conversion drivers like simplified quote forms, clear calls to action, and fast page loads before adding complex features.
Failing to update local SEO listings causes missed opportunities when customers search for nearby automotive services. Set quarterly reviews of Google My Business, industry directories, and citation sources to maintain accuracy. Inconsistent business information confuses search engines and customers alike.
Common troubleshooting scenarios:
High traffic but low conversions indicates targeting mismatch or poor user experience once visitors arrive
Good rankings but minimal traffic suggests targeting wrong keywords with low search volume
Strong mobile traffic but high bounce rates points to mobile-specific usability problems
Leads submitting forms but not converting to customers signals lead quality issues or poor follow-up processes
Declining rankings after optimization often results from technical errors or search algorithm updates requiring adjustments
Avoiding website mistakes starts with understanding how automotive customers behave differently than other industries. They research extensively, compare multiple businesses, and expect immediate information about availability and pricing.
